您现在的位置是:首页 >科技 > 2025-03-07 10:19:34 来源:

📚考研数据结构考点 🚀 希尔排序 – 希尔排序与顺序表结合的方法 🔄

导读 在考研复习的过程中,数据结构是不可或缺的一部分,其中排序算法更是重中之重。今天,我们就来探讨一个特别有趣的排序方法——希尔排序(Sh

在考研复习的过程中,数据结构是不可或缺的一部分,其中排序算法更是重中之重。今天,我们就来探讨一个特别有趣的排序方法——希尔排序(Shell Sort)以及它如何与顺序表(Sequential List)完美结合。🔍

希尔排序是一种插入排序的改进版本,通过将原始列表分割成多个子序列,分别进行直接插入排序,从而实现更高效的排序效果。相较于传统的插入排序,希尔排序能够在较早阶段减少数据项之间的距离,使得后续的排序过程更加高效。🎯

当你遇到需要对顺序表进行排序的问题时,可以考虑利用希尔排序的优势。通过对顺序表的不同步长进行分组排序,最终达到全局有序的效果。这种方法不仅提高了排序效率,还增强了代码的可读性和维护性。🛠️

掌握希尔排序与顺序表结合的方法,不仅能帮助你在考研中取得更好的成绩,还能为未来的编程之路打下坚实的基础。💪

考研复习 数据结构 希尔排序